Enter the Dragons
Offering a prayer in front of a double dragon incense holder at Hanoi's Temple of Literature. Dragons in Chinese culture are symbols of imperial power particularly associated with the emperor. Two dragons represent great power squared, and two dragons facing each other symbolizes the balance of forces (Yin and Yang) working in harmony.
